The Grünwald-Letnikov Method is a numerical approach used to solve fractional differential equations by extending the classical concepts of calculus to non-integer order derivatives. This method employs a discrete approximation that generalizes the Taylor series to fractional orders, making it suitable for modeling processes described by fractional derivatives, which often capture complex behaviors in real-world systems.
